summaryrefslogtreecommitdiffstats
path: root/drivers/base/power/domain.c (follow)
Commit message (Expand)AuthorAgeFilesLines
* PM / domains: Fix up domain-idle-states OF parsingUlf Hansson2018-02-071-31/+45
* PM / genpd: Stop/start devices without pm_runtime_force_suspend/resume()Rafael J. Wysocki2018-01-151-10/+15
* PM / domains: Don't skip driver's ->suspend|resume_noirq() callbacksUlf Hansson2018-01-111-13/+17
* PM / Domains: Remove obsolete "samsung,power-domain" checkGeert Uytterhoeven2017-12-131-14/+2
* Merge branch 'pm-qos'Rafael J. Wysocki2017-11-131-4/+2
|\
| * PM / QoS: Fix device resume latency frameworkRafael J. Wysocki2017-11-081-1/+1
| * Merge branch 'pm-domains' into pm-qosRafael J. Wysocki2017-11-081-64/+153
| |\
| * | PM / QoS: Drop PM_QOS_FLAG_REMOTE_WAKEUPRafael J. Wysocki2017-10-141-3/+1
* | | PM / Domains: Fix genpd to deal with drivers returning 1 from ->prepare()Ulf Hansson2017-11-081-2/+3
| |/ |/|
* | PM / domains: Rework governor code to be more consistentRafael J. Wysocki2017-11-081-1/+1
* | PM / Domains: Remove gpd_dev_ops.active_wakeup() callbackGeert Uytterhoeven2017-11-081-11/+3
* | PM / Domains: Allow genpd users to specify default active wakeup behaviorGeert Uytterhoeven2017-11-081-0/+3
* | PM / Domains: Add support to select performance-state of domainsViresh Kumar2017-10-141-0/+98
* | PM / Domains: Rename genpd internals from pm_genpd_* to genpd_*Ulf Hansson2017-10-111-54/+50
|/
* PM / Domains: Convert to using %pOF instead of full_nameRob Herring2017-08-251-7/+7
* PM / Domains: Extend generic power domain debugfsThara Gopinath2017-07-241-10/+195
* PM / Domains: Add time accounting to various genpd statesThara Gopinath2017-07-241-0/+32
*-. Merge branches 'intel_pstate' and 'pm-domains'Rafael J. Wysocki2017-07-201-4/+4
|\ \
| | * PM / Domains: defer dev_pm_domain_set() until genpd->attach_dev succeeds if p...Sudeep Holla2017-07-191-4/+4
* | | Merge tag 'pm-extra-4.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/gi...Linus Torvalds2017-07-111-2/+3
|\ \ \
| | \ \
| | \ \
| *-. | | Merge branches 'pm-domains', 'pm-sleep' and 'pm-cpufreq'Rafael J. Wysocki2017-07-101-2/+3
| |\ \| | | | | |/ | | |/|
| | * | PM / Domains: provide pm_genpd_poweroff_noirq() stubArnd Bergmann2017-07-041-0/+1
| | * | Revert "PM / Domains: Handle safely genpd_syscore_switch() call on non-genpd ...Rafael J. Wysocki2017-07-041-2/+2
* | | | Merge tag 'armsoc-drivers' of git://git.kernel.org/pub/scm/linux/kernel/git/a...Linus Torvalds2017-07-041-4/+4
|\ \ \ \ | |/ / / |/| | |
| * | | PM / Domains: Allow overriding the ->xlate() callbackThierry Reding2017-06-131-4/+4
| | |/ | |/|
* | | Merge branches 'pm-domains', 'pm-avs' and 'powercap'Rafael J. Wysocki2017-07-031-25/+78
|\ \ \ | |/ / |/| / | |/
| * PM / Domains: Fix unsafe iteration over modified list of domainsKrzysztof Kozlowski2017-06-291-2/+2
| * PM / Domains: Fix unsafe iteration over modified list of domain providersKrzysztof Kozlowski2017-06-291-2/+2
| * PM / Domains: Fix unsafe iteration over modified list of device linksKrzysztof Kozlowski2017-06-291-2/+2
| * PM / Domains: Handle safely genpd_syscore_switch() call on non-genpd deviceKrzysztof Kozlowski2017-06-291-2/+2
| * PM / Domains: Call driver's noirq callbacksMikko Perttunen2017-06-291-9/+59
| * PM / Domains: Constify genpd pointerKrzysztof Kozlowski2017-06-281-7/+10
| * PM / Domains: pdd->dev can't be NULL in genpd_dev_pm_qos_notifier()Viresh Kumar2017-06-221-1/+1
* | Merge tag 'armsoc-drivers' of git://git.kernel.org/pub/scm/linux/kernel/git/a...Linus Torvalds2017-05-091-2/+0
|\ \ | |/ |/|
| * PM / Domains: Do not check if simple providers have phandle cellsDave Gerlach2017-04-041-2/+0
* | PM / Domains: Ignore domain-idle-states that are not compatibleLina Iyer2017-03-291-7/+9
* | PM / Domains: Don't warn about IRQ safe device for an always on PM domainUlf Hansson2017-03-291-2/+6
* | PM / Domains: Respect errors from genpd's ->power_off() callbackUlf Hansson2017-03-291-1/+2
* | PM / Domains: Enable users of genpd to specify always on PM domainsUlf Hansson2017-03-291-2/+12
* | PM / Domains: Clean up code validating genpd's statusUlf Hansson2017-03-291-10/+9
* | PM / Domain: remove conditional from error caseViresh Kumar2017-03-291-5/+5
|/
* PM / Domains: Power off masters immediately in the power off sequenceUlf Hansson2017-02-231-6/+11
* PM / Domains: Rename is_async to one_dev_on for genpd_power_off()Ulf Hansson2017-02-231-6/+9
* PM / Domains: Move genpd_power_off() above genpd_power_on()Ulf Hansson2017-02-231-81/+81
* PM / Domains: Fix asynchronous execution of *noirq() callbacksUlf Hansson2017-02-091-29/+39
* PM / Domains: Correct comment in irq_safe_dev_in_no_sleep_domain()Ulf Hansson2017-02-081-1/+1
* PM / Domains: Rename functions in genpd for power on/offUlf Hansson2017-01-271-36/+36
* PM / domains: Fix 'may be used uninitialized' build warningAugusto Mecking Caringi2016-12-311-0/+1
* avoid spurious "may be used uninitialized" warningLinus Torvalds2016-12-251-0/+1
* PM / Domains: Fix compatible for domain idle stateLina Iyer2016-12-061-1/+1